Karunya University 2008 B.E Information Technology Operating systems - Question Paper

Thursday, 24 January 2013 01:55Web

ans ALL ques.
PART – A (10 x one = 10 MARKS)
1. What is FLIPS?
2. What is a CPU – bound process?
3. Define : Compaction.
4. What is TLB?
5. What is the use of index?
6. What is latency time in disk?
7. Define: Semaphore
8. Name 2 transmission media used in networks.
9. Define: Monitor.
10. Name a multi user OS.

PART – B (5 x two = 10 MARKS)
11. Differentiate ranging from a microkernel and a monolithic kernel.
12. Compare best fit and 1st fit placement strategies.
13. What is double buffering?
14. Define: Critical part.
15. What are the conditions for deadlock to occur?

PART – C (5 x eight = 40 MARKS)
16. a. Explain the different process state transitions. (5)
b. Discuss about interrupt processing. (3)
(OR)
17. a. Explain the concept of deadline scheduling. (4)
b. Explain HRN scheduling. (4)

18. Explain the address translation in combined paging / segmentation system.
(OR)
19. Discuss about locality of reference and working set of a process.

20. Discuss the different non-contiguous storage allocation.
(OR)
21. Discuss about security kernels and OS penetration.

22. Explain Dekker's algorithm for implementing mutual exclusion.
(OR)
23. How is process synchronization done using semaphores.

24. Explain the Banker's algorithm for deadlock avoidance.
(OR)
25. Discuss about memory management in UNIX.
